How to Choose the Best Bunk Beds for Teens

Bunk and loft beds can add fun and utility to children's rooms. They can also help to save space.

Look for bunk beds that are able to be moved, such as those with bottom storage drawers or a trundle that is easy to remove. There are also twins that can be stacked and divided to create two separate beds. Also, think about the weight of the top bunk.

Size

When choosing a bunk bed for your kids you should consider size, style, and safety. Check the height of the ceiling to ensure that the bunks can fit in the space. Also, make sure that there's enough space around the bunks to allow the kids to move. The beds should be spaced sufficiently apart that kids can safely move up and down without having to hit each other or the walls. Additionally, you should find out if the top bunk can support mattresses of the same size as the bottom one so you won't need for a trundle or an additional bed in the future.

You can also choose an arrangement for your bunk that isn't conventional and suited to your space better. An L-shaped bunk beds usa bed could be ideal for a small room or a guest room shared by two people. It is a great way to save the floor space and can also accommodate a queen or twin over full mattress on the lower and upper levels, depending on which model you pick.

A lot of the top bunk beds for teens can grow with your kids by converting into two independent beds when it's the right time to transition to a regular double bed. For instance the Storkcraft Solid Wood Ladder Twin Bunk Bed has an elegant farmhouse-inspired design with curved headboards and wagon-inspired guardrails along the top bunk. It's made of knot-free New Zealand Pine and has an integrated stationary ladder that connects the lower and upper bunk beds. This creates more space for kids to play.

A loft bed is a different option that makes the most of the space at the corner in rooms with tweens. It's a great option for smaller spaces as it doesn't take up as much vertical room and also allows the lower level to be used as a desk, dressers or storage cabinets. It's an excellent choice for older children because it doesn't require stairs or ladders, making it more accessible for adults and children of larger sizes.

Check the height of any bunk bed in your child's room using blue painter tape. This will give you a sense of whether it is easily climbed in and out at night without causing any damage to heads or the bottom of the window sill or hanging curtains. You should also think about the safety of your family by examining the Consumer Product Safety Commission regulations for bunk beds. These regulations include guardrails as well as features that protect against falls and entrapment.

Safety

Bunk beds are a great option for families with children of all ages, but it is important to think about safety features when buying. You'll need bunk beds with guardrails that are tall enough to keep children from falling or becoming trapped and a mattress that doesn't raise up the sleeping surface too much. You should also pay attention to the weight capacity, since certain bunks have a lower limit than others.

When you are choosing the bunk bed you want, look on its manufacturer's website for specifications on the mattress sizes and weight limits. The majority of manufacturers will offer guidelines for the maximum thickness of the top bunk mattress. They'll also list the maximum weight capacity of the upper bunk bed and the bunk.

The best childrens bunk beds bunk beds are sturdily constructed, and the ladder or stairs should attach to the frame securely and be equipped with side handles for safety. Avoid bunk beds that have slatted side panels, as they are dangerous for children to climb, especially if they're poorly joined. If your kids love playing on the ground, go for a bunk with a low-slung bottom to allow them to sit up and play without being too high off the floor.

Consider an L-shaped bed if don't have a lot of space in your child's bedroom or if you do not want it to take up much space. They take up less space and are typically only larger than a single bed. This makes them suitable for small rooms with low ceilings. They're also more suitable for younger kids, who may be intimidated by a higher bunk.

If you have a little more space, you can opt for an over-full or full-over-full bunk bed. These are the most fashionable and safe bunk beds available. They can be used for full-size or twin-sized beds. Pottery Barn Kids' Belden bunk bed is an elegant and sturdy choice that grows with your child as they grow. It can even accommodate Trundle beds (sold separately) to accommodate older teens and adults. It is Greenguard Gold certified, meaning it releases low levels of chemical. It is made from sustainably sourced Baltic Birch wood, and is available in a variety of colors.

Style

If it's a shared room or just one child, the perfect bunk bed can give teenagers something to be happy about. Many designs are minimalist and sleek and some have more playful elements. Bunk beds are available in various sizes, such as twin-overtwin, full-overfull and even queen. A twin over full style is popular with teens since it allows them to sleep two kids in the same space and still leave room for a dresser, desk or storage drawers in the bottom. Some options come with trundle bed that allows the upper level to fit an additional mattress.

Teens also adore the twin over king loft bed, which takes up less floor space and provides them with more space to sprawl out or work from home, says Fenton. A metal bunk bed with an extended guardrail is a popular option for older children because it's "built to last, and is the most sturdy grown-up bunk available," she adds.

Take a look at a T-shaped or L-shaped design, which is essentially an elevated platform bed. These beds are designed with the ladder at the end. This gives them a sleeker look and more space to set up a desk or dresser. They're not as efficient at saving space as a traditional bunk, but they're a stylish option for teenagers that offers more space in their rooms.

Consider a futon bunk If you're looking for bunk beds that are affordable and offers security and comfort. Futons are lightweight and portable which means they can be moved around when you're looking to revamp your child's bedroom in the future. They're not as sturdy as wood or metal bunk beds, and the top bed isn't equipped with guardrails.

Bunks with ladders or stairs are also available. Ladders take up less space and are more convenient to climb, while stairs are safer and can double as a seat for smaller kids. Some models are able to convert into a desk and chair, allowing your child to create the perfect bedroom set-up to study or play.

Budget

A bunk bed is an expensive purchase, so it's essential to take into consideration your budget when shopping. While there are plenty of inexpensive options out there, if you're planning on purchasing a bunk bed that is designed to last until the teens (or even into adulthood) it might be worth paying a bit more for a high-quality design that can be used for a long time.

Before you start shopping think about who will be using the bunk bed, and what their sleeping needs might be. A twin-overtwin arrangement is ideal for siblings who share a bedroom, while a full over full bunk is a great option for adults who want to save space or avoid the expense of a separate queen-sized mattress. You'll need to determine the amount of headroom between the top and bottom bunk. If your children are still in their toddler beds, you may want to choose a configuration that is lower than the ground.

The ideal bunk bed for teens will be a good value and one that will grow with them. Choose a style that will fit in both traditional and modern rooms. Or, choose the Oeuf Perch Bunk Bed, an Editors' Choice for the Spruce. It can be split into two twin beds if required. This design features a clean, contemporary silhouette, boucle-upholstered guardrails and a stationary ladder that's easy for kids to climb and descend and down. It's Greenguard Gold and Fair Trade certified for its environmental and social responsibility.

A childrens bunk bed bed with built-in storage is another way to save money. This could include drawers beneath the bed, or shelves underneath the top. This will help keep your bedroom clutter-free and is particularly useful for those who have a small space. Many of the bunks on our list feature this feature.
